My advice being a newbie myself (currently in Super Starter Month 2) would be to set up at least four FIRM shows for your FIRST SS month. I told my friends about it before I signed and asked them to help me out by having a show. I told them about all of the free products I would earn if I met my $1250 goal and four of them were willing to host for me in my first month. I had sales of $1326 for the month and earned my SS1 Bonus, plus a new consultant bonus.
Having the UPS guy drop off all my free stuff was a real motivator! I guess the gist of my advise is - SET YOUSELF UP TO WIN! Plan it out and you will be successful. Good Luck!

What are the potential earnings as a Pampered Chef consultant?

Earnings as a Pampered Chef consultant can vary widely based on factors such as sales volume, the number of parties hosted, and personal effort. Consultants earn a commission on sales, which typically ranges from 20% to 25%, and can also earn bonuses and incentives based on performance. Many consultants find that their income increases as they build a customer base and expand their network.
